Commetrex offers free, T.38 interoperability testing to any developer wishing to achieve interoperability
between Commetrex' TerminatingT38™ product and any other field-tested T.38-based system. Interoperability
problems are often caused by different interpretations of the T.38 recommendation. For example,
do sequence numbers continue to increase from negotiation through image transfer or do they reset
to zero with the image? How are the most significant bits and bytes ordered? These are simple
problems, but they are enough to hinder interoperability. Although they are easy to change, they
are tough to find.
Commetrex' centralized testing facility, combined with unparalleled experience in interop testing, accelerates
interoperability, and findings are communicated to participants without compromising any confidences.
TerminatingT38 allows Commetrex' T.38 Lab engineers to terminate hundreds of T.38 sessions into one
medium-speed PC. And it's heavily instrumented, so there is no doubt as to what's going on during a session.
A participant's trace is also analyzed, and advice provided as to what equipment may be causing a problem.
Interoperability success is often achieved within two to 10 days.
